BARBARA & LUKÁŠ

French Impressionist Claude Monet’s paintings of water
lilies hold a fascination for many people, but few design their wedding in the paintings’ romantic style and colour palette like Barbara
and Lukáš did. The couple from Bratislava now live in the Netherlands, Lukáš proposed in Ireland, but for logistical reasons the couple decided to get married
in Slovakia. “While looking for a venue we came across
a blog showcasing eleven special places in Slovakia, one of which was the Wieger Villa.
It was love at first sight.
We liked the idea of having the ceremony in a charming garden beside the Svätý Jur vineyards and the reception inside the villa,”
says Barbara, describing the couple’s dream location. The preparations took a year and a half. They opted for a part-planned system, meaning that the Holubica wedding agency guided them through the planning process
and coordinated the wedding day itself, but the couple themselves communicated with the various suppliers.
The date of the wedding was deliberately set for 9 May, the date of Barbara’s
grandparents’ wedding just over fifty years earlier.
A May wedding means abundant greenery and lots of seasonal flowers, whose colours
matched the Monet concept of the wedding. The water lily motif featured on the invitations and stationery and even on the cake, and instead of a photo booth,
the wedding guests could have their portrait painted in watercolours.
The civil ceremony took place at 4 pm in the garden,
after which the 57 guests moved inside the villa where a festive plated menu awaited
them, a mix of classics and slightly unconventional dishes.
There was a buffet about an hour before midnight and the entertainment continued
with a DJ until 4 in the morning. After the revelry,
the newlyweds flew straight to Vietnam for their honeymoon, two weeks spent travelling the country from north to south.
“The materialisation of Monet’s Water Lilies as the inspiration and theme of the whole
wedding exceeded our expectations. It added an unforgettable emotional
layer to the event. Thanks to the amazing coordinator and suppliers,
we were able to enjoy our big day without worries and stress. We loved everything about our wedding.” There are perhaps only
two things they would have changed. “We would have tried even
harder to imprint every second on our memories, and I’d have practised the
first dance in an outfit similar to my wedding dress so I didn’t get so caught up in it,” Barbara says with a smile.
